    Jannik Sinner victorious over Roberto Carballes Baena 6-4 7-6(5) in the quarter in Umag on Friday. Sinner will face Franco Agamenone in the semifinal. The battle lasted 2 hours and 18 minutes. This will be his best result in this competition. In the past, the best he could do in the past was reaching the 2nd round in 2019. Here you can see his history at this event.

    At the end of the match, Jannik scored 81 points vs. the Spaniard’s 66.

    Sinner

    Sinner served very well to win 83% of the points (29/35) behind his first serve, and he won 61% points (20/33) on his second serve. The Italian won this match even if he was struggling when converting his break points as he converted only 22% (2/9) of the procured opportunities.

    Carballes Baena

    On the other side, Carballes Baena was exceptional in converting the only break point that he converted. Nevertheless, that was not enough to win the match.

    After this contest, the head to head between Sinner and Carballes Baena is 2-0 for Jannik.

    The set was pretty even as both players managed to hold serve with the notable exception of 1 break that the Italian snatched in the 3rd game (2-1) before ultimately winning the set (6-4).

    The Italian was clinical in converting the only break point that he conquered in the 3rd game (1-1 15-40). On the other side, Jannik didn’t concede a single break point during this set.

    They contested 59 points. Sinner conquered the set after winning 9 more points than Roberto (34-25). Sinner conceded 8 points on serve (22-8). On the other side, the Spaniard conceded 12 points on serve (17-12).

    Jannik won the set after he broke Carballes Baena in the 11th (6-5) game. Roberto tried to stage a comeback breaking in the 12th (6-6) game. Notwithstanding, Jannik didn’t blink to finally clinch the set at the following tiebreak at 5.

    Sinner failed to serve out the set when leading 6-5 to be broken at 30.

    Jannik missed the chance to break Roberto in the 3rd game when he had 3 consecutive chances (0-40).

    Tiebreak

    Jannik won 3 minibreaks in the 4th (3-1), 8th (6-2) and 12th (7-5) point. On the other side, Roberto won 2 minibreaks in the 10th (4-6) and 11th (5-6) point.

    This was the tiebreak sequence: 0-1, 1-1, 2-1, 3-1, 3-2, 4-2, 5-2, 6-2, 6-3, 6-4, 6-5, 7-5

    The Italian converted 12% of his break points (1/8). He had 8 break points opportunities in the 3rd (1-1 0-40, 15-40, 30-40, 40-A and 40-A) and the 11th game (5-5 15-40, 30-40 and 40-A). On the other side, Roberto was clinical in converting the only break point that he conquered in the 12th game (5-6 30-40).

    They played 88 points. Sinner won 4 more points than the Spaniard (46-42). Jannik conceded 12 points on serve (27-12). Regarding the other side of the net, Roberto conceded 19 points on serve (30-19).
